Little Uchee Plantation is a 445 +/- acre high fence game preserve located in Salem, Alabama, along the banks of Uchee Creek. With over four miles of high fencing in place, Little Uchee is the ideal tract for the hunting enthusiast with one thing in mind- MONSTER Whitetails. This amazing tract is in a prime location of Lee County, Alabama, within 20 to 30 minutes of the Auburn, Opelika, Phenix City and Columbus, Georgia areas and within 2.5 hours of Birmingham and 2 hours of Atlanta.

This plantation farm for sale is a rolling tract, heavily stocked with a mature stand of pine and hardwood timber. The hardwood timber on this tract is about as good as it gets, with the dominant species being white oak. This is a great food source for the deer in the preserve in the fall and winter. This abundance of mast bearing trees also increases the carrying capacity of the deer herd in the preserve. There are also numerous other species of hardwood trees including red oak, water oak, poplar and gum. There is some mature pine mixed in with the hardwood stands and also two stands of once thinned planted pines on the east and west end of the tract. There are 10 food plots on Little Uchee ranging in size from 1/4 acre up to about 4 acres, all strategically placed so the deer don’t have to travel far for food. These areas serve as winter food plots and the bigger ones double as summer plots, with great stands of lush green clover and chicory. Most all food plots have new enclosed shooting houses for ultimate comfort while hunting.

An underground gas line dissects the tract east to west, offering additional open land for food plots and a great place to hunt when the bucks are chasing does during the rut. If you like to dove hunt, there are a couple areas; one about 4 acres and the other about 20 acres. The 20 acre open area would also be great for horses or other livestock. Access is great throughout the preserve. Numerous roads and ATV trails will take wherever you want to go. There is also a good road around the whole preserve along the high fence, making maintenance and vegetative control an easy task.

Little Uchee is named after Uchee Creek, a big creek that is the northern boundary of the preserve and eventually flows into Lake Eufaula. The high fence follows Uchee Creek for almost 1.5 miles with gates along the way allowing access to the creek. There are a couple small springs that provide a good water source for the deer and other wildlife, and also supply flowing water to the ponds on the preserve. There are 3 ponds that are naturally stocked with bass, bream and catfish, offering fishing for the whole family.

The native deer herd on Little Uchee was completely eradicated a few years ago to make way for the superior genetic whitetails that are now in the preserve. The current population within the preserve consists of three mature four year old bucks and about 60 other deer, many of which were pregnant does that have fawned once and will be fawning again real soon. The other deer released were a combination of buck and doe fawns. Yearling bucks with very impressive horns can already be seen roaming around in the preserve. Aside from the impressive deer herd, there is a healthy turkey population on Little Uchee. The rolling hills of this recreational property, with the big, upland hardwood stands, is a perfect recipe for a memorable turkey hunt.

For your overnight or weekend stay, there is a 2,000 SF, 3 BR / 2 BA house with a two car garage. This house has been completely remodeled and is near completion. Near the house is a metal shop building, with front and rear roll up doors, a perfect place for equipment maintenance and repair. For storage of all equipment, ATVs, trailers and other items, a 40′ x 108′ pole barn was recently constructed on site. Also on Little Uchee is a very nice, large enclosed barn, built years ago for horse purposes and complete with stalls, concrete floor, and living quarters with kitchen and bathroom. This barn is currently used in the breeding operation on Little Uchee but could be used for numerous other purposes.
